Background technique
Reaction cup is placed in the implementation in storing mechanism there are two types of mainstream on chemiluminescence instrument at present: 1, will be intrinsicPackaged form, proper alignment reaction cup be added to instrument internal, such as 601 electrochemical luminescence of Roche;2, instrument configuration has automaticallyCup device is managed, bulk reaction cup automatically arranging order test can be supplied and be used;Relative to first way, second of sideFormula is with consumables cost is low, takes the advantage that reaction cup robot manipulator structure is simple, labor intensity of operating staff is low.
Existing reaction cup is equipped with a pair of of lug as shown in Figure 4 and Figure 5 usually at the rim of a cup of cup body, and lug is equipped withSymmetrical openings are towards the groove on the outside of rim of a cup.For example, the utility model patent that Patent document number is " 205374484 U of CN " isFor the reaction cup sending mechanism of the type reaction cup, including discharging barrel, bracket component, driving assembly, push away cup assembly, conveying groupPart goes out cup assembly, horizontal feed component and reaction cup, wherein goes out cup assembly and includes right shell body, leads glass block and right baffle-plate, leads cupBlock, which is arranged between right shell body and right baffle-plate and leads, constitutes the sliding slot that reaction cup goes out cup between a glass block, right shell body and right baffle-plate, butIn actual use, when reaction cup enters the channel of cup assembly, there are the following problems: reaction cup falls not this patentIt is smooth to be easy to cause card cup, so that entire reaction cup conveying be made to interrupt.

The present embodiment provides a kind of reaction cups of automatic cup stacking machine structure to go out cup assembly, as shown in Figure 1, reaction cup goes out cup assemblySide plate including two sides and the sole piece among side plate are formed with out cup channel, the side plate and bottom between side plate and sole pieceShape, the direction change of block make to show that glass channel is followed successively by out cup assembly tilting section 601 and out cup group from into rim of a cup to cup mouthPart vertical section 602, the side plate include cup assembly tilting section left plate 6012 and tilting section right side plate 6013 and out cup groupPart vertical section left plate 6022 and vertical section right side plate 6023, the sole piece include cup assembly tilting section sole piece 6011 and out cupComponent vertical section sole piece 6021;As shown in Fig. 2, the opposite left side of vertical section left plate 6022 and vertical section right side plate 602360222 and right side 60232 on form symmetrical left guide protrusions 60221 and right guide protrusions 60231;As shown in figure 3, going outCup assembly vertical section 602 is divided into contraction section from high to low, limits section and relaxes section, and contraction section limits section and relaxes section threeThe height ratio of person is 1.3-1.7:0.3-0.5:1, such as 1.3:0.3:1,1.5:0.4:1,1.7:0.5:1, in which:
The distance between left guide protrusions 60221 and right guide protrusions 60231, left side on sustained height in contraction sectionDistance is gradually reduced from high to low between 60222 and right side 60232, and left guide protrusions 60221, right guide protrusions60231, left side 60222 and right side 60232 are arc, after reaction cup falls into contraction section first, two lug cards of reaction cupIn left guide protrusions 60221 and right guide protrusions 60231, reaction cup is along left guide protrusions 60221 and right guide protrusions60231 fall, while left guide protrusions 60221, right guide protrusions 60231, left side 60222 and right side 60232 are arcShape plays the role of buffering reaction cup, adjustment and limited reactions cup position, the reaction cup of various postures originally is made to be adjusted to baseThis vertical direction plays the role of finishing reaction cup posture, while preventing reaction cup card cup.
Limit in section the distance between left guide protrusions 60221 and right guide protrusions 60231 and left side on sustained heightThe distance between face 60222 and right side 60232 remain unchanged;The main function of limit section is the angle of oscillation of limited reactions cupDegree, after limiting section, reaction cup is fallen with vertical direction;
Relax in section the distance between left guide protrusions 60221 and right guide protrusions 60231 and left side on sustained heightThe distance between face 60222 and right side 60232 are high to Low first to become larger, and then remains unchanged or continues to become larger, can subtract in this wayFew reaction cup interacts with collision and friction of cup assembly etc. out, reduces card cup probability.Relaxing section side plate, there are many form, figures7 give tri- kinds of form schematic diagrames of A, B, C: A form relaxes in section left guide protrusions 60221 and right guide protrusions on sustained height60231 distance and the distance of left side 60222 and right side 60232 first become larger from top to bottom, then remain unchanged,B form relaxes the distance and left side 60222 of left guide protrusions 60221 and right guide protrusions 60231 on sustained height in sectionIt is become larger from top to bottom with the distance of right side 60232, C-shaped formula relaxes in section left 60221 He of guide protrusions on sustained heightThe distance of right guide protrusions 60231 and the distance of left side 60222 and right side 60232 are first fast in the form of arc from top to bottomSpeed becomes larger, and then remains unchanged.
After actual measurement, a secondary card just occurs when continuous operation is 2000 times average for reaction cup Cup arrangement machine structure using the above structureCup, significantly reduces the probability of card cup.
As shown in Figure 4 and Figure 5, reaction cup includes cup body, the cross-sectional shape of cup body be it is rectangular, it is symmetrical in the rim of a cup of cup bodyEquipped with a pair of of lug, symmetrical openings are formed on the lug towards the groove on the outside of rim of a cup, so that 60221 He of left guide protrusionsRight guide protrusions 60231 stick into the groove of reaction cup.
As shown in figure 4, in contraction section on sustained height left guide protrusions 60221 and right guide protrusions 60231 it is maximum away fromIt is 0.5~1mm small from the distance between outermost than two lugs of reaction cup a, such as 0.5mm, 0.8mm, 1mm;It limits same in sectionThe distance of left guide protrusions 60221 and right guide protrusions 60231 is than the distance between the bottom of two groove of reaction cup b in one heightBig 0.5~0.6mm, such as 0.5mm, 0.55mm, 0.6mm;Left side 60222 and right side 60232 in contraction section and limit sectionSpacing is 0.3~0.4mm bigger than the distance between the outermost of two lugs of reaction cup a, such as 0.3mm, 0.35mm, 0.4mm.
As shown in figure 5, limit section length it is 3~4mm bigger than the height c of two lugs of reaction cup, can prevent in this way byCard cup phenomenon caused by colliding and rub etc. and interact in reaction cup and limit section.
